Hi - hate to admit defeat but really use some help please

Quick background of problem

mallory park - last session running total loss battery starts giving up hard to keep revs up then stops dead.

Back to pits Change battery and top up fuel - won't start just occasional impressive backfire - try mates cdi and change plugs but exactly the same. Call it a day and go home

Back in workshop change both coils - no change
Whip off carbs check over and refit - no change
Dismantle fuel tap (mod done a while ago) - diaphragm dislodged a bit so corrected - no change
Lose the plot completely - engine out complete strip down (done a few of these so getting used it now !) can't find any problems, nothing broken, all lugs still on cams etc, new head gaskets reassemble - no sodding change
Bite the bullet brand new battery and brand new set of plugs - best spark I've ever seen ! - no change !!!!
Swap carbs for spare set - no change
Checked all wiring (race loom) and resistor + resistance of pulse coils all appear ok
Tried 2 different cdi's borrowed from mate - no change
Checked all earth points and even ran separate earth wires to coils etc direct from battery - still the same !

So to summarize more or less changed or checked everything I can think of but still won't run just turns over then sodding great backfire and flame out of the can.

Anyone seen this before ? Any ideas/help greatly appreciated, probably something really stupid !!

Really at a loss - starting to think it's never going to run again

remove the engine cover and check the timing trigger disk , grab hold of it and try to turn it , it shouldnt move , i think its on the RHS

i had this problem in the past

I didnt listen to my dad that said if you have backfiring through the carbs you have a timing issue

I dismissed it as timing is fixed in these motors

but help from here and i checked the trigger disk and it had seperated and moved

spark fuel and compression and it should run but not if the spark is at the wrong time

I'd try cleaning the plugs again and trying some easy start down the carbs or just squirt a few drops a fuel down each carb. If it doesnt try to run on that, youll need a strobe light to check the timings right. Oh yeah dont earth the wires to the coil, the cdi switches the ground and has a constant 12v going to them.
I had this same prob on me trail bike, the guy i bought them off actually bought another bike which had the same fault! Good for me tho, just took a while to figure out (nakered CDIs)!
